| <li>Compile and use GLEW with the <tt>GLEW_MX</tt> preprocessor token | ||||
| defined.</li> | ||||
| <li>For each rendering context, create a <tt>GLEWContext</tt> object | ||||
| that will be available as long as the rendering context exists.</li> | ||||
| <li>Define a macro or function called <tt>glewGetContext()</tt> that | ||||
| returns a pointer to the <tt>GLEWContext</tt> object associated with | ||||
| the rendering context from which OpenGL/WGL/GLX calls are | ||||
| issued. (This dispatch mechanism is primitive, but generic.) | ||||
| <li>Replace the global <tt>glewInit()</tt> call with | ||||
| <tt>glewContextInit(glewGetContext())</tt>. Note, that the | ||||
| <tt>GLEWContext</tt> pointer returned by <tt>glewGetContext()</tt> has | ||||
| to reside in global or thread-local memory. Also, remember to call | ||||
| <tt>glewContextInit</tt> after creating the <tt>GLEWContext</tt> object | ||||
| in each rendering context. | ||||
| </ol> | ||||
